I got myself a new computer. And I'm determined to set it up within a reasonable timeframe (normally it takes me ages to do technical things).

I'm wondering how do I put on HL2DM. I presume I use the dvd again and wait for steam to update it (will take days Rolling Eyes ).

But what files should I try and carry over. I'll bring my maps but what else. Should I try and carry across everything in my username folder?

Even better - is there a simple way of hooking the two PCs up and transfer files between them?

Any help appreciated - I'm scared.

see these .gcf files? C:\Program Files\Valve\Steam\steamapps

those are shared files .. you can copy those..

if It were Me I would copy over the .gcf files.
the sounds folder from hl2dm
the materials folder from hl2dm
and the maps folder from hl2dm

and I would burn 2 dvdr's

ALSO ,.. i remember you having a good connection.. I don't think steam will take that long to update. so if you don't mind starting the updating and going for a walk in that case I would only really be concerned about the map folder and the sounds folder.. stuff yeah.
